When Merchant was with 10,000 Maniacs she made her name singing on albums and EPs like “Human Conflict Number Five” in 1982, “The Wishing Chair” in 1985, “Blind Man’s Zoo” in 1989 and “Our Time In Eden” in 1992. With these albums and others the group was a popular alternative rock band of the 1980s and has continued to this day with a revised line up.

But 1993 saw Merchant leave 10,000 Maniacs and embark on her own career, emerging in 1995 with her debut solo album “Tigerlily”, which featured songs like “I May Know the Word”, “Beloved Wife” and the chart-topping “Carnival”. She would return with “Ophelia” in 1998, which once again earned her immediate critical success and it would eventually go Platinum in the United States. She had made her mark and as the years have rolled by she has continued to find success with “Motherland” in 2001, “The House Carpenter’s Daughter” in 2003 and, most recently, “Leave Your Sleep” in 2010.
